Cocotte Bistro is looking for a passionate and skilled Chef de Partie to join its kitchen team. Reporting to the Executive Chef and Sous Chef, the Chef de Partie is responsible for managing a specific kitchen station while ensuring consistency, quality, and efficiency in food preparation and service.

Key Responsibilities
• Oversee and manage a designated kitchen station during service
• Prepare, cook, and present dishes according to Cocotte Bistro’s standards
• Ensure consistency, quality, and presentation of all plates
• Assist with daily mise en place and prep planning
• Support junior cooks and contribute to a positive kitchen environment
• Maintain cleanliness and organization of the workstation
• Follow all food safety, hygiene, and sanitation standards
• Collaborate with the culinary team to ensure smooth service
• Contribute to menu execution and continuous improvement of recipes

Profile Requirements
• Proven experience as a Chef de Partie or strong experience as a Line Cook ready to step up
• Solid culinary techniques and understanding of classic cooking methods
• Ability to work efficiently in a fast-paced, team-oriented environment
• Strong organizational skills and attention to detail
• Passion for quality ingredients and execution
• Reliability, professionalism, and a positive attitude
• Availability for evenings, weekends, and holidays
• Culinary diploma or equivalent experience (an asset)
